Transaction 8fdaf71e31f51561478340876d1046e159c0851e80138fea151b8dff1d6736b4
1 Input
1 Output
-
8fdaf71e31f51561478340876d1046e159c0851e80138fea151b8dff1d6736b4: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 51b8516010c3fdaaf8a044c2df7c306e2eb2a40db2f5e28870cda18e4fca7e0b
- address
- bc1p2xu9zcqsc076479qgnpd7lpsdcht9fqdkt679zrsekscun720c9smx2fc0